Transaction 556584926d52ce706f49d62cfa645926881dbebadae4e7ea987ae6891155fdad
1 Input
2 Outputs
- 556584926d52ce706f49d62cfa645926881dbebadae4e7ea987ae6891155fdad:0
- 556584926d52ce706f49d62cfa645926881dbebadae4e7ea987ae6891155fdad:1
value 875600
address 3JHUas1MW6WXduAFa4tK1D6Widi2D9EbDn
value 1273916
address 1C8qSXiupvQrNhrW8sox6LGx3skryaaPKT